Underwood's 6.5mm Creedmoor 122gr Controlled Chaos Solid Monolithic Ammo is a high-performance round designed for precision shooting and hunting. This ammunition features a 122-grain jacketed hollow point bullet, offering controlled expansion and deep penetration. With its solid monolithic construction, this rifle ammunition provides excellent accuracy and terminal performance. Ideal for long-range shooting and medium to large game hunting, this 6.5 Creedmoor ammunition delivers consistent and reliable results.

About Underwood Ammo:
Underwood Ammo, founded in 2013, has quickly established itself as a premier manufacturer of high-performance ammunition. Based in Sparta, Illinois, Underwood is known for pushing the boundaries of ballistic performance, often producing some of the hottest factory loads available on the market. The company specializes in creating ammunition that maximizes the potential of various calibers, from handgun to rifle cartridges. Underwood's commitment to quality is evident in their use of top-tier components and rigorous testing procedures. Their innovative approach includes the development of proprietary bullet designs like the Controlled Chaos, which offers exceptional terminal performance. Underwood Ammo is particularly favored by enthusiasts and professionals who demand the utmost in ballistic performance and reliability from their ammunition.
